Product Description:
The MDD090B-N-040-N2M-110GA0 is a three-phase synchronous motor manufactured by Bosch Rexroth Indramat as part of the MDD Synchronous Motors series. It is intended for use with digital drive controllers, where it provides tightly regulated torque and speed in servo loops for automated transfer stations, indexing tables, and similar industrial axes. Through permanent-magnet excitation and internal position feedback, the unit supports rapid acceleration and repeatable positioning during cyclic motion. This makes it suitable for axes that must start, stop, and reverse direction frequently while maintaining stable motion control.
Balancing is standard, so vibration levels remain controlled without additional counterweights. The centering pilot measures 110 mm, giving an accurate seating reference for flanges or gearboxes. Power and signal lines exit on Side A through a modular connector, which helps keep cable routing orderly in compact machine layouts. At standstill, the motor can deliver 7.2 Nm of continuous torque, which supports inverter matching and thermal planning. Under rated excitation, it reaches a nominal speed of 4000 rpm, allowing direct coupling to moderate-inertia loads while still providing a wide operating range for dynamic positioning. The 090 frame with B length keeps the motor compact enough for installation in confined machinery spaces.
Feedback is provided by an integrated multiturn absolute encoder, and Digital servo feedback (DSF) transmits position data to the drive across multiple revolutions. Because the feedback system is built into the motor, the controller can monitor rotor position continuously during motion and after direction changes. The motor is supplied without a blocking brake, so vertical or suspended loads require external holding force when power is removed. The output uses a plain shaft with a shaft seal, which helps protect internal bearings from coolant splash and dust ingress. Side B remains closed, and the housing is not fitted with a second connection point on that end.
